Unveiling the Magic of Ella Fitzgerald's Scat Singing in 'Summertime

This episode topic centers on the legendary jazz musician Ella Fitzgerald, with a particular focus on her vocal versatility and her role in pioneering scat singing. The hallmark of the article would be an in-depth look at her iconic rendition of the song "Summertime," from George Gershwin's opera "Porgy and Bess." This piece would explore Fitzgerald's musical genius, how she used her voice as an instrument, and the emotional depth she brought to her performances, making "Summertime" a timeless classic in the jazz canon. Through this article, readers would gain insight into why Ella Fitzgerald is celebrated as "The First Lady of Song" and how her contributions to jazz have left an indelible mark on the genre.

Uncovering the Origins of Jazz in African, European, and Caribbean Traditions

This podcast esplores the origins of jazz, tracing its genesis back through the confluence of African, European, Caribbean, and early American musical influences. It argues that jazz arose as a unique creative act of cultural resilience, adaptation, and innovation, emerging from centuries of cultural exchange and hardship stemming from the slave trade. Analyzing jazz's background reveals a history often obscured in traditional narratives.The essay shows how rhythmic concepts, percussion instruments, and improvisatory traditions retained from Africa provided jazz's underlying aesthetic framework. European harmonies, orchestral arrangements, and brass/woodwind instruments also profoundly shaped jazz as a genre. Additionally, circulating Caribbean rhythms and musical forms demonstrated possibilities for hybridization that impacted jazz. Finally, New Orleans is highlighted as the site where these circulating streams coalesced through musical gumbo, with Congo Square and Storyville as key locales in jazz's birth. This multi-faceted inheritance gave rise to a brilliant new genre that continues influencing worldwide audiences.
